The method of image enhancement under extremely low-light conditions

Abstract: The process of obtaining the image with normal exposure time from the image with short
exposure time photographed in extreme low-light conditions is defined as the image enhancement
under extreme low-light conditions. In this paper, we proposed a method for the enhancement of the
extreme low-light image based on the encoding-and-decoding network architecture and residual block.
We designed an end-to-end fully convolutional network as the translation model, which consists of
two parts: the encoding-and-decoding network and refinement network. The input data of the
translation model is the extreme low-light raw data captured with short exposure time in extreme
low-light conditions, and the output data is the image in RGB format. Firstly, the low-frequency
information of the image was reconstructed via U-net and then was input into the residual network to
reconstruct the high-frequency information of the image. Through the experiments carried out on the
SID data set and comparisons with previous research results, it is proved that the method described in
this paper can effectively enhance the visual effect of the images captured under extreme low-light
conditions and improved with low-light enhancement, and increase the expression of the image
details.
